On 6/6/05, Kevin Handy <kth at srv.net> wrote:
> You could make one like DEC used to: Take an 8-slot backplane, and
> fill in four of the slots with epoxy. You now have a 4 slot backplane.
Ahhhhgggg! Ever seen that with a BA123? Makes you cry... DEC didn't
want their graphical workstations being converted to departmental
server use, so they plugged up the extra holes in the backplane to
prevent expansion. For a while, one could order a virgin backplane
from spares, but they eventually caught on (then they stopped hosing
workstation customers so much ;-)
Fortunately, I've only ever seen it at a DECUS (DEC-owned demo
machines); none of the machines I've worked with or personally owned
were broken this way.
